The street in brief

Kelston Close is a street almost entirely of terraced houses. Too few recent sales to put a reliable current figure on the street — the wider SO15 figures below are the better guide.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£4,420, above the district's £3,136.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; SO15 prices as a whole have been rising. With 6 sales across 5 homes since 1998, homes here come to market only rarely.
